Difference between Reisen, Fahren, Gehen
I can not make a clear difference of when tu use this verbs depending on the situation.
For example:
Ich gehe -----> I am leaving
Ich fahre----> I travel or I go to some place with a transport
Ich Reise -----> I travel but to different City ?

gehen = to go on foot (caminar)
fahren = to go by car/bus/any kind of transport
reisen = to travel(viajar)
February 16, 2015
"Gehen" can also have the meaning of "leaving" in some cases.
when you say to your friend after you spend time at his house with him "Ich gehe jetzt"
